Powder metallurgy Common sense
Powder compacts' common defects and the reasons
1. Uneven density.
Reasons are: 
1) Each part compression ratio is inconsistent;
2) Low mould finish, increased the friction resistance;
3) Lack of lubrication;
4) Unreasonable parts size (Length-diameter ratio is too big, length-thickness ratio is too big. etc);
5) Compressing method is wrong.

2. Crack.
Reasons are: 
1) The uneven density;
2) Poor formability, Greater Flexibility after cpmpacting;
3) Demoulding way is wrong;
4) Poor rigidity of the mould;
5) Mould has back taper.

3. Edge Damage.
Reasons are: 
1) Powder formability is poor;
2) Powder compact's density is low.

4. Surface Scratch.
Reasons are: 
1) The mold surface has scratch;
2) The mold has a tumor.
